19/06/2020 · PA Safety Inspection $47.95 (includes $8 sticker / program management fee) +tax. There is a $10+ surcharge for commercial vehicles, vans, and large trucks. PA Emissions Inspection: $16.86 (includes $1.57 sticker / program management fee) +tax: Motorcycle Inspection: $27.78 (includes $8 sticker / program management fee) +tax

Can you get an exempt sticker for 5000 miles?

If 5000 miles or less are put on a vehicle in a year, the shop can provide an exempt sticker to save some money . Other than that, there is not a lot of wiggle room when it comes to inspections. The state of Pennsylvania is very adamant about making sure all cars are properly inspected.

Do inspection fees go towards repairs?

Fees are not set in stone, as each shop has the ability to do what they want with pricing. If a vehicle does fail inspection, the inspection fee does not go towards the repair. However, a person will need to get that repair done before being able to pass inspection.

Why do we need a safety inspection in Pennsylvania?

Safety Inspection Program. Pennsylvania requires vehicle safety inspections to ensure that vehicles are maintained for safe operation. Safety Inspections can prevent vehicle failure on the highways and crashes that may result in injuries or death.
